Lapinlahti is a Finnish municipality located in the North Savo region (Pohjois-Savo), roughly midway between the towns of Kuopio and Iisalmi. Set on the shores of Lake Onkivesi, it offers a typically Savonian landscape of expansive waters, coniferous forests and a peaceful rural setting. The climate is continental and northern, with long, snowy winters well suited to cross-country skiing, ice fishing and snowshoeing, and short but bright summers ideal for swimming, boating and lakeside walks. The area retains an authentic, unspoilt character, away from major tourist routes, making it well suited to those seeking quiet surroundings and Finland's natural landscape in its simplest form. The 73100 postcode covers the town centre and its immediate surroundings. Lapinlahti also serves as a convenient base for exploring the wider North Savo region, known for its many lakes, traditional saunas and a rural way of life that remains very much part of everyday living.
